Lord Huron, Mine Forever Review
Lord Huron, Mine Forever Review Lord Huron is a Los Angeles-based indie-folk band that first made a name for themselves with their debut album Lonesome Dreams and shortly after Strange Tales, which featured the triple-platinum single “The Night We Met.” In 2018, Lord Huron earned widespread critical acclaim with their first Top 5 debut on the Billboard Top … Read more